演算法筆記 - Matrix - 網路郵局 乘法(Strassen's Algorithm) http://en.wikipedia.org/wiki/Strassen_algorithm 首先把兩個 矩陣相乘,改成兩個一樣大的方陣 相乘。把 矩陣改成稍大的方陣,長寬是2的次方,多出來的元素全部補零。 原理是Divide and...
演算法筆記- Matrix 當今世上最快的矩陣相乘演算法,時間複雜度為O(N^2.3727)。不過方法相當複雜, 我也不懂。 矩陣相乘的速度究竟可以到達 ...
CH 2 演算法時間複雜度(The Complexity of Algorithms) 演算法效率分析. •影響程式 ... 矩陣相乘 void mul(int a[ ][ ], int b[ ][ ], int c[ ][ ], int n). { int i, j, k, sum; for (i=0; i < n; i++) for (j=0 ...
【原创】矩阵相乘复杂度分析_dreamtomvp_新浪博客 2013年5月1日 ... 矩阵乘法m*k的矩阵X上k*n的矩阵,得到m*n的矩阵 复杂度是O(m*k*n)。 顺便举例,一 维向量相乘,如果是(n*1)X(1*n)复杂度就是O(n*n),如果 ...
施特拉森演算法- 维基百科,自由的百科全书 Strassen演算法是個計算矩陣乘法的演算法。 ... 現時時間複雜度最低的矩陣乘法 演算法是Coppersmith-Winograd方法的一种扩展方法,其算法复杂度为O(n2.3727) 。
1.3 算法的复杂度分析 n:问题的规模. □ 时间复杂度表示方法:. : T(n) = O(f(n)). 11-3. 时间复杂度分析举例 . 例n阶矩阵相乘的算法. 阵相乘的算法. for ( i = 1; i
矩陣與時間複雜度的關係? - Yahoo!奇摩知識+ 在作矩陣加法的時候就會處理N^2次個元素 而新矩陣每個元素的產生都只會花了O( 1)的時間作加法 矩陣相乘如果沒有特別說的話應該是O(N^3).
1 若有兩個大小均為nn的矩陣,則將其中一個矩陣轉置的時間複雜度為何?這兩矩陣 相加的時間複雜度為何?這兩個矩陣相乘的時間複雜度為何? 答:矩陣轉置的時間 ...
資料結構簡介 空間方面則是指程式在電腦記憶體所佔的空間大小,稱為「空間複雜度」。 由於電腦硬 ... 2n2+2n+1 ≤ 5n2,因此f(n)=O(n2) 。 時間複雜度範例三. 【矩陣相乘】. 執行次數.
matrix multiplication algorithm time complexity - Stack Overflow for i=1 to n for j=1 to n c[i][j]=0 for k=1 to n c[i][j] = c[i][j]+a[i][k]*b[k][j] ... The naive algorithm, which is what you've got once you correct it as noted in comments, ...